**Ticket #4471 — Staging env misconfigured for soft deletes**

Hey, welcome aboard! Quick one: the staging box for Cartwheel isn't flagging soft-deleted rows in the orders table, so purged orders keep showing up in reports. Turns out the cleanup worker can't auth against the archive service. Add the missing line to staging's env file, right after the DB settings:

sealed setting: COURIER_KEY8=0dbae41b

Alert: soft-delete rate anomaly on the orders table in Marrowline. This fires when the ratio of rows flagged deleted_at exceeds 5% of daily order volume, which may indicate a bulk-deletion script, a misfiring retention job, or unauthorized data tampering. Soft-deleted rows remain queryable by admin roles, so review access logs alongside the spike. Triage steps and the restore procedure are documented on the page below.

wiki page, tahaf-tajog: https://jira.ordindyn.corp/pipeline

// PROFILE_SHARD_COUNT: fixed at 64 for the Heronbank user-profile store.
// Changing this requires a full rehash migration — the consistent-hash
// ring does not support in-place resizing. Reviewers: reject any patch
// touching this without an attached migration plan. The build this
// constant last changed in is identified by the token below.

session token of tajef-bageg = htk21_5d90d574934f3ccae6437